#!/usr/bin/env bash
# Bash Strict Mode
set -euo pipefail
IFS='
'
cd -P "$(dirname "$0")"
PS4='-\D{%F %T} '
export DEBIAN_FRONTEND=noninteractive
export DEBIAN_PRIORITY=critical
# Fix Debian 10 bug (https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=905409)
PATH=/sbin:/usr/sbin:$PATH
function sysConfig() {
echo "Enter the server FQDN $(tput setaf 2)[System: $(hostname)]$(tput sgr0):"
read serverFQDN
hostnamectl set-hostname $serverFQDN
echo "Enter the server Time Zone $(tput setaf 2)[System: $(cat /etc/timezone)]$(tput sgr0): "
read serverTZ
timedatectl set-timezone $serverTZ
# Navigate to tmp
cd /tmp
# Debian stable OS
apt-get update
apt-get -y -o "Dpkg::Options::=--force-confdef" -o "Dpkg::Options::=--force-confold" upgrade
apt-get -y dist-upgrade
# Disable OpenStack SSH malware
mv /home/debian/.ssh/authorized_keys /root/.ssh/authorized_keys || :
sed -i '/Generated-by-Nova/d' /root/.ssh/authorized_keys || :
chown root:root /root/.ssh/authorized_keys || :
# Terminal goodies
touch .hushlogin
cat <<'EOF' >>/root/.bashrc
export LS_OPTIONS="--color=auto"
eval "`dircolors`"
alias ctop="docker run --rm -it --name=ctop -v /var/run/docker.sock:/var/run/docker.sock:ro quay.io/vektorlab/ctop"
alias df="df --si"
alias du="du -cs --si"
alias free="free -h --si"
alias l="ls $LS_OPTIONS -al --si --group-directories-first"
alias less="less -i"
alias nano="nano -clDOST4"
alias pstree="pstree -palU"
export HISTCONTROL=ignoreboth
export HISTFILESIZE=
export HISTSIZE=
export HISTTIMEFORMAT="%F %T "
export DOCKER_BUILDKIT=1 COMPOSE_DOCKER_CLI_BUILD=1
EOF
cat <<'EOF' >>/etc/inputrc
set completion-ignore-case
set show-all-if-ambiguous On
set show-all-if-unmodified On
EOF
cat <<'EOF' >>/etc/bash.bashrc
if ! shopt -oq posix; then
if [ -f /usr/share/bash-completion/bash_completion ]; then
. /usr/share/bash-completion/bash_completion
elif [ -f /etc/bash_completion ]; then
. /etc/bash_completion
fi
fi
EOF
# Basic packages
apt-get -y install man bash-completion git ufw jq curl build-essential wget psmisc lz4 file net-tools brotli unzip zip moreutils dnsutils fail2ban xauth sysfsutils rsync iperf pv tree mc screen ssh iotop htop awscli whois sudo
# Enable time synchronization
timedatectl set-ntp true
# Configure screen
cat <<'EOF' >>/etc/screenrc
startup_message off
shell -$SHELL
defscrollback 100000
bind l eval clear "scrollback 0" "scrollback 100000"
EOF
# Configure SSH
cat <<'EOF' >>/etc/ssh/sshd_config
Port 521
PasswordAuthentication no
AllowUsers root
X11UseLocalhost no
EOF
systemctl restart ssh
touch /root/.Xauthority
# Firewall
ufw allow in 80/tcp
ufw allow in 443/tcp
ufw allow in 521/tcp
ufw allow in 8080/tcp
ufw allow in 8082/tcp
ufw logging off
ufw --force enable
ufw --force delete 6
ufw --force delete 6
ufw --force delete 6
ufw --force delete 6
ufw --force delete 6
# Optimize
systemctl disable apt-daily.timer apt-daily-upgrade.timer remote-fs.target man-db.timer
sed -i 's/MODULES=most/MODULES=dep/g' /etc/initramfs-tools/initramfs.conf
sed -i 's/COMPRESS=gzip/COMPRESS=lz4/g' /etc/initramfs-tools/initramfs.conf
echo 'RESUME=none' >>/etc/initramfs-tools/conf.d/resume
update-initramfs -u
echo 'GRUB_TIMEOUT=0' >>/etc/default/grub
update-grub
apt-get -y purge apparmor exim\*
for i in $(seq 0 "$(nproc --ignore 1)"); do
echo "devices/system/cpu/cpu${i}/cpufreq/scaling_governor = performance" >>/etc/sysfs.conf
done
# Disable sleep when closing laptop screen
echo HandleLidSwitch=ignore >>/etc/systemd/logind.conf
# noatime
sed -i 's| / ext4 | / ext4 noatime,|g' /etc/fstab
# Disable swap
swapoff -a
sed -i '/swap/d' /etc/fstab
# Docker
curl -fsSL https://get.docker.com -o get-docker.sh && bash get-docker.sh && apt-get -y install docker-compose
# NodeJS
curl -fsSL https://deb.nodesource.com/setup_20.x | bash && apt-get install -y nodejs
# Git
apt-get update && apt-get -y install git
# Generate SSH key
ssh-keygen -ted25519 -f ~/.ssh/id_ed25519 -N ''
# Use Cloudflare DNS server
echo 'supersede domain-name-servers 1.1.1.1;' >>/etc/dhcp/dhclient.conf
# Cleanup
sed -i '/^deb-src/d' /etc/apt/sources.list
apt-get update
apt-get -y purge unattended-upgrades
apt-get -y autoremove --purge
apt-get clean
# SSH Keys Infra Team
curl https://github.com/{harryvasanth,frenchris,kigiri}.keys >>~/.ssh/authorized_keys
# Create Core directories
mkdir -p /root/core/scripts/misc
}
